Fiber Optic in 5G Networks: High Bandwidth, Low Latency Connectivity
As the world increasingly relies on high-speed data transfer for applications like cloud computing, the need for ultra-fast and reliable networks has become paramount. 5G technology promises to deliver this by leveraging cutting-edge infrastructure, with fiber optic cables playing a essential role in achieving its ambitious goals. Fiber offers significantly higher bandwidth capacities compared to traditional copper wiring, enabling the transmission of vast amounts of data at lightning speed. This translates in exceptionally low latency, which is crucial for real-time applications such as self-driving soc security operation center cars and augmented reality.
- Additionally, fiber's immunity to electromagnetic interference ensures a stable and secure connection, minimizing data loss and interruptions.
- Therefore, fiber optic cables are indispensable components in the deployment of 5G networks, enabling the delivery of seamless and high-performance connectivity to users worldwide.

VMware vSphere Security Best Practices: Leveraging ESIx for Enhanced Protection
In today's dynamic threat landscape, securing virtualized environments is paramount. VMware vSphere provides a robust platform with built-in security features, but it's crucial to implement best practices for comprehensive protection. One such practice involves leveraging the powerful capabilities of ESXi's Defense infrastructure, enhancing overall system resilience. By implementing granular access controls, employing secure boot processes, and utilizing strong encryption methods, administrators can mitigate risks and create a fortified virtualized ecosystem.
- Deploying robust firewall rules at the ESXi host level is essential for restricting unauthorized network traffic and safeguarding sensitive data.
- Regularly refreshing ESXi firmware and vSphere components ensures that vulnerabilities are addressed promptly, minimizing the attack surface.
- Performing vulnerability assessments and penetration testing provides valuable insights into potential weaknesses, enabling proactive remediation efforts.
By embracing these best practices and leveraging ESIx's functions, organizations can establish a secure foundation for their vSphere deployments, effectively combating evolving threats and ensuring the integrity of their virtualized infrastructure.
